# 265884 11-May-2014 gnn

MFC: 263302, 264461, 264772

263302:
fix mbuf leak if it does not fit in software queue

264461:
Commit various fixes for the SolarFlare drivers, in particular
this set of patches fixes support for systems with > 32 cores.

Details include

sfxge: RXQ index (not label) comes from FW in flush done/failed events

Change the second argument name of the efx_rxq_flush_done_ev_t and
efx_rxq_flush_failed_ev_t prototypes to highlight that RXQ index (not label)
comes from FW in flush done and failed events.

sfxge: TXQ index (not label) comes from FW in flush done event

Change the second argument name of the efx_txq_flush_done_ev_t prototype to
highlight that TXQ index (not label) comes from FW in flush done event.

sfxge: use TXQ type as label to support more than 32 TXQs

There are 3 TXQs in event queue 0 and 1 TXQ (with TCP/UDP checksum offload)
in all other event queues.

264772:
Check that port is started when MAC filter is set

The MAC filter set may be called without softc_lock held in the case of
SIOCADDMULTI and SIOCDELMULTI ioctls. The ioctl handler checks IFF_DRV_RUNNING
flag which implies port started, but it is not guaranteed to remain.
softc_lock shared lock can't be held in the case of these ioctls processing,
since it results in failure where kernel complains that non-sleepable
lock is held in sleeping thread.

Both problems are repeatable on LAG with LACP proto bring up.

# 227569 16-Nov-2011 philip

Add the sfxge(4) device driver, providing support for 10Gb Ethernet adapters
based on Solarflare SFC9000 family controllers. The driver supports jumbo
frames, transmit/receive checksum offload, TCP Segmentation Offload (TSO),
Large Receive Offload (LRO), VLAN checksum offload, VLAN TSO, and Receive Side
Scaling (RSS) using MSI-X interrupts.
